Serbia - Petroleum and Natural Gas Extraction Support Activities Wages and Salaries
In 2018, the country was ranked number 9 among other countries in Petroleum and Natural Gas Extraction Support Activities Wages and Salaries at €24.3 Million. Serbia is overtaken by Croatia, which was number 8 with €44.3 Million and is followed by Hungary with €11.1 Million. Norway ranked the highest with €2,526 Million in 2019, that is +2.9% compared to 2018. United Kingdom, Denmark and France respectively ranked number 2, 3 and 4 in this ranking. Denmark recorded the best 5 years average growth at +5.1% per year, while Hungary witnessed the worst performance at -15.7% per year.
